openstack怎么学习
时间: 2024-02-02 17:03:36 浏览: 33
学习OpenStack可以按照以下步骤进行:
1. 了解OpenStack的架构和组件:OpenStack是一个由多个组件组成的开源云计算平台,包括计算、网络、存储等多个方面。需要了解各个组件的功能和作用,以及它们之间的关系。
2. 安装和配置OpenStack:可以在本地或者云上搭建OpenStack环境,通过实践来了解OpenStack的使用和配置流程。
3. 使用OpenStack进行云计算操作:可以使用OpenStack进行虚拟机、网络、存储等云计算操作,了解OpenStack的实际应用。
4. 学习OpenStack API和SDK:OpenStack提供了RESTful API和SDK,可以使用它们来进行程序化的云计算操作。
5. 参与OpenStack社区:加入OpenStack社区,参与讨论、贡献代码和文档等,深入了解OpenStack的发展和应用。
除此之外,还可以参考一些OpenStack的官方文档和社区资源,例如OpenStack官方文档、OpenStack Wiki、OpenStack Summit等。
相关问题
OpenStack学习
OpenStack是一个开源的云计算平台,可以用于构建公共云、私有云和混合云。OpenStack由许多不同的组件组成,包括计算、存储、网络、身份认证等,可以实现弹性计算、弹性存储、弹性网络等服务。
以下是学习OpenStack的一些步骤和资源:
1.了解OpenStack的基础概念和组件。可以从官方文档开始学习,也可以查看相关的书籍和视频教程。
2.安装和配置OpenStack。可以使用DevStack进行快速部署,也可以使用Packstack或者Fuel等工具进行部署。部署过程中需要注意一些配置参数和网络设置。
3.学习OpenStack的各个组件的用法和管理方法。例如,Nova用于计算实例的创建和管理,Neutron用于网络的配置和管理,Cinder用于块存储的管理等等。
4.了解OpenStack的API和命令行工具。OpenStack提供了RESTful API和命令行工具,可以进行自动化操作和编写脚本。
5.学习OpenStack的扩展和定制。OpenStack提供了很多的插件和扩展,可以对其进行定制和扩展,以满足特定的业务需求。
6.参与OpenStack社区。OpenStack是一个活跃的开源社区,可以通过参与社区贡献自己的代码、文档或者问题解决方案。
参考资源:
1.官方文档:https://docs.openstack.org/
2.OpenStack基础教程:https://www.ibm.com/developerworks/cn/cloud/library/cl-openstack-basics/
3.OpenStack实战:https://www.cnblogs.com/kevingrace/p/9787593.html
4.OpenStack社区:https://www.openstack.org/community/
5.OpenStack中国社区:https://www.openstack.cn/
openstack学习文档
以下是一些 OpenStack 学习文档:
1. OpenStack 官方文档:官方文档提供了关于 OpenStack 各个组件的详细信息,包括安装、配置、操作和管理等方面的指导。
2. OpenStack 基础教程:这是一份针对初学者的 OpenStack 教程,提供了基本的概念和操作指导。
3. OpenStack 技术指南:这是一份详细的技术指南,深入介绍了 OpenStack 各个组件的架构和操作原理。
4. OpenStack 入门指南:这是一份面向初学者的入门指南,提供了基本的概念和操作指导,适合初步了解 OpenStack。
5. OpenStack 实践指南:这是一份针对实践的指南,提供了实际部署和管理 OpenStack 的指导,帮助使用者掌握实际操作技能。
6. OpenStack 管理指南:这是一份针对管理员的指南,提供了管理 OpenStack 的一些技巧和工具,帮助管理员更好地管理 OpenStack。
7. OpenStack 社区指南:这是一份介绍 OpenStack 社区的指南,介绍了社区的组织结构、社区文化、如何参与社区等内容。